The Evolution of XP Software Development

Extreme Programming (XP) is a software development methodology that emphasizes customer satisfaction, flexibility, and continuous improvement. It is known for its agile approach to development, focusing on collaboration, feedback, and simplicity.

Key Principles of XP

XP is guided by several key principles that shape the way software is developed:

  • Communication: XP promotes open communication among team members, stakeholders, and customers to ensure everyone is on the same page throughout the development process.
  • Simplicity: The emphasis on simplicity in XP encourages developers to create straightforward solutions that meet the project’s requirements without unnecessary complexity.
  • Feedback: Continuous feedback loops are integral to XP, allowing for quick adjustments and improvements based on real-time input from users and stakeholders.
  • Courage: XP encourages courage in decision-making, empowering team members to take risks and make bold choices in pursuit of innovation.
  • Respect: Respect for individuals and their contributions is fundamental in XP, fostering a positive team dynamic and a supportive work environment.

The XP Process

In an XP development cycle, software is built incrementally through short iterations called sprints. Each sprint focuses on delivering a specific set of features or improvements based on customer priorities. Testing is integrated throughout the process to ensure quality at every stage.

Encourage pair programming to improve code quality and knowledge sharing among team members.

Encouraging pair programming in XP software development can significantly enhance code quality and promote knowledge sharing within the team. By pairing up developers to work together on writing code, reviewing each other’s work, and discussing solutions in real-time, teams can catch errors early, brainstorm creative solutions, and benefit from diverse perspectives. This collaborative approach not only leads to higher-quality code but also facilitates the transfer of expertise among team members, fostering a culture of continuous learning and improvement.
